[PATCH 4/6] audio: Fix lines over 90 characters


From: Zhang Han
Subject: [PATCH 4/6] audio: Fix lines over 90 characters
Date: Thu, 14 Jan 2021 16:10:57 +0800

Fix the line width of code.

Signed-off-by: Zhang Han <zhanghan64@huawei.com>
---
 audio/dsoundaudio.c | 37 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++----------
 1 file changed, 27 insertions(+), 10 deletions(-)

diff --git a/audio/dsoundaudio.c b/audio/dsoundaudio.c
index 38ae2471f6..1891a38bee 100644
--- a/audio/dsoundaudio.c
+++ b/audio/dsoundaudio.c
@@ -89,7 +89,9 @@ static void dsound_log_hresult (HRESULT hr)
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_ALLOCATED
     case DSERR_ALLOCATED:
-        str = "The request failed because resources, such as a priority level, 
were already in use by another caller";
+        str = "The request failed because resources, "
+              "such as a priority level, were already in use "
+              "by another caller";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_ALREADYINITIALIZED
@@ -104,7 +106,8 @@ static void dsound_log_hresult (HRESULT hr)
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_BADSENDBUFFERGUID
     case DSERR_BADSENDBUFFERGUID:
-        str = "The GUID specified in an audiopath file does not match a valid 
mix-in buffer";
+        str = "The GUID specified in an audiopath file "
+              "does not match a valid mix-in buffer";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_BUFFERLOST
@@ -114,22 +117,31 @@ static void dsound_log_hresult (HRESULT hr)
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_BUFFERTOOSMALL
     case DSERR_BUFFERTOOSMALL:
-        str = "The buffer size is not great enough to enable effects 
processing";
+        str = "The buffer size is not great enough to "
+              "enable effects processing";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_CONTROLUNAVAIL
     case DSERR_CONTROLUNAVAIL:
-        str = "The buffer control (volume, pan, and so on) requested by the 
caller is not available. Controls must be specified when the buffer is created, 
using the dwFlags member of DSBUFFERDESC";
+        str = "The buffer control (volume, pan, and so on) "
+              "requested by the caller is not available. "
+              "Controls must be specified when the buffer is created, "
+              "using the dwFlags member of DSBUFFERDESC";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_DS8_REQUIRED
     case DSERR_DS8_REQUIRED:
-        str = "A DirectSound object of class CLSID_DirectSound8 or later is 
required for the requested functionality. For more information, see 
IDirectSound8 Interface";
+        str = "A DirectSound object of class CLSID_DirectSound8 or later "
+              "is required for the requested functionality. "
+              "For more information, see IDirectSound8 Interface";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_FXUNAVAILABLE
     case DSERR_FXUNAVAILABLE:
-        str = "The effects requested could not be found on the system, or they 
are in the wrong order or in the wrong location; for example, an effect 
expected in hardware was found in software";
+        str = "The effects requested could not be found on the system, "
+              "or they are in the wrong order or in the wrong location; "
+              "for example, an effect expected in hardware "
+              "was found in software";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_GENERIC
@@ -154,7 +166,8 @@ static void dsound_log_hresult (HRESULT hr)
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_NODRIVER
     case DSERR_NODRIVER:
-        str = "No sound driver is available for use, or the given GUID is not 
a valid DirectSound device ID";
+        str = "No sound driver is available for use, "
+              "or the given GUID is not a valid DirectSound device ID";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_NOINTERFACE
@@ -169,12 +182,14 @@ static void dsound_log_hresult (HRESULT hr)
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_OTHERAPPHASPRIO
     case DSERR_OTHERAPPHASPRIO:
-        str = "Another application has a higher priority level, preventing 
this call from succeeding";
+        str = "Another application has a higher priority level, "
+              "preventing this call from succeeding";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_OUTOFMEMORY
     case DSERR_OUTOFMEMORY:
-        str = "The DirectSound subsystem could not allocate sufficient memory 
to complete the caller's request";
+        str = "The DirectSound subsystem could not allocate "
+               "sufficient memory to complete the caller's request";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_PRIOLEVELNEEDED
@@ -189,7 +204,9 @@ static void dsound_log_hresult (HRESULT hr)
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_UNINITIALIZED
     case DSERR_UNINITIALIZED:
-        str = "The Initialize method has not been called or has not been 
called successfully before other methods were called";
+        str = "The Initialize method has not been called "
+              "or has not been called successfully "
+              "before other methods were called";
         break;
 #endif
 #ifdef DSERR_UNSUPPORTED
